public ActionResult CreateFilm() { try { var film = new Film(); UpdateModel <Film>(film); var filmEp = new FilmEpisode(); UpdateModel <FilmEpisode>(filmEp); film.createDate = DateTime.Now; var user = Session["USER_SESSION"] as Movie_Web.Common.UserSession; film.createBy = user.UserName; film.releasedEpisodes = 1; film.totalEpisodes = 1; var filmDao = new FilmDAO(); filmDao.insertFilm(film); filmEp.Episode = 1; int res = new FilmEpisodeDAO().CreateFilmLe(filmEp); if (res > 0) { return(RedirectToAction("Films")); } else { ModelState.AddModelError("", "Thêm mới không thành công"); } return(View("CreateFilmLe")); } catch { //return View(); //Console.WriteLine("Error"); return(View()); } }
public int updateEpisode(FilmEpisode filmEp) { var filmID = new SqlParameter("@filmID", filmEp.filmID); var Episode = new SqlParameter("@Episode", filmEp.Episode); var linkEpisode = new SqlParameter("@linkEpisode", filmEp.linkEpisode); int res = dbFilmContext.Database.ExecuteSqlCommand("exec UpdateFilmEpisode @filmID , @Episode , @linkEpisode", filmID, Episode, linkEpisode); return(res); }
public int CreateFilmLe(FilmEpisode filmepLe) { var filmID = new SqlParameter("@filmID", filmepLe.filmID); var Episode = new SqlParameter("@Episode", filmepLe.Episode); var linkEpisode = new SqlParameter("@linkEpisode", filmepLe.linkEpisode); int res = dbFilmContext.Database.ExecuteSqlCommand("exec AddFilmEpisode @filmID , @Episode , @linkEpisode", filmID, Episode, linkEpisode); return(res); }
public ActionResult addFilmEpisode(FilmEpisode ep) { int res = new FilmEpisodeDAO().CreateTapPhim(ep); string message = "SUCCESS"; if (res > 0) { var filmBoID = ep.filmID; var filmDao = new FilmDAO(); var inforFilm = filmDao.getFilmByID(filmBoID); inforFilm.releasedEpisodes = inforFilm.releasedEpisodes + 1; filmDao.dbFilmContext.SaveChanges(); return(Json(new { Message = message, JsonRequestBehavior.AllowGet })); } message = "Failed"; return(Json(new { Message = message })); }